    As a lover of Taco Bell I was curious how it would compare to Del Taco. I ordered door dash so everything wasn't quiet as fresh but I was happy overall and the price was right. Iced Coffee (Cafe de olla)- I'm a bit of a coffee snob and I would order this one again. Deff better than McDonalds or Taco Bell iced coffee, just a touch of flavor but not overpowering. Real strawberry Sprite - it was good, reminded me of a Shirley Temple. The straws are very wide tho like smoothly straws and the strawberries were getting stuck which was a bit annoying. Refreshing but nothing to write home about. Regular size Queso & chips - thought it was on the smaller side considering they make an even smaller snack size. I am a lover of Queso and this one was creamy with added flavors and would deff order again. Tortilla chips were crunchy and plain. Snack Taco - basically the same thing as Taco Bell's hard taco, with a slightly different meat flavor/texture Snack Queso quesadilla- this was the only thing I didn't enjoy. It was basically a soft taco with melted cheddar cheese and another soft taco stacked on top, and then folded in half. It was too much tortilla and not really queso to be found. Would be better with just one tortilla. Crispy chicken taco with ranch - reminded me of a Wendy's snack wrap or Taco Bell's cantina crispy chicken taco. Enjoyed the chicken strip, no complaints.
